Florida lawmakers pass bill to ban social media for children under 16
- Florida lawmakers passed a bill to ban social media for children under 16 to protect their mental health against addictive features.
- The bill would require some social media platforms to verify the age of account holders, block children under 16 from creating accounts, and close existing ones.
- The legislation, approved 23-14, is now awaiting Republican Governor Ron DeSantis' decision to sign or veto it.
